Due D: Fortune 100 co's using GSCP file transfer servers: Here are some of the big name users. These are fairly new products, you know, and Globalscape has these big companies as customers already. Real clients, right now. It's a partial list for you to consider, so you know the type of company Globalscape is keeping. One thing to note: Globalscape keeps adding clients without making big press releases about it. Be aware of that. Other companies would be sending news releases to the Express News and so forth. This is not a hype it up company. When you see the list below, you should get a better grasp of that. These are very large, Fortune 100-500 companies that are right now using Globalscape file transfer server software. The partial list: Dell HP Invent PriceWaterhouseCoopers JPMorgan Mitsubishi Electric GAP Adobe IBM Rolls-Royce Bistol-Myers Squibb Konica Minolta ACNielsen AIG The Royal Bank of Scotland First Federal Bank of California Eye Care Centers of America Cornell University United States of America Embassy Cap Gemini Ernst & Young Johns Hopkins University NavSea Warfare Center Mellon United National Bank Northrop Grumman Rockwell Automation Olympus Federal Home Loan Bank of NY ----------------------------------------------- The above is some chit chat from another board..
